Warning Signs You Need Condo Water Extraction
Water damage can be sneaky, but there are warning signs you shouldn’t ignore. Catching these sign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ems. Our team is here to help you identify the signs and get the help you need.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Unpleasant odors in your condo can be a sign of underlying water damage. Don’t ignore the smell; it’s a sign of a bigger problem. Our team can help you identify the source and provide a solution.
Buckled or Warped Flooring
Water damage can cause flooring to buckle or warp. This is not just an aesthetic issue; it’s a safety concern. Our team can help you assess the damage and provide a solution to get your flooring back to normal.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age. Don’t ignore it; it’s a sign of a bigger problem. Our team can help you identify the source and provide a solution.
Water Stains or Discoloration
Water stains or discoloration on walls or ceilings can be a sign of water damage. Don’t ignore it; it’s a sign of a bigger problem. Our team can help you assess the damage and provide a solution.
Visible Water Leaks
Visible water leaks can be a sign of a bigger problem. Don’t ignore it; it’s a safety concern. Our team can help you assess the damage and provide a solution.
Increased Humidity
Increased humidity in your condo can be a sign of water damage. Don’t ignore it; it’s a sign of a bigger problem. Our team can help you assess the damage and provide a solution.
